Headnote

1. The existence of partiality under Article 24 EPC can be determined on the basis of the following two tests:

Firstly, a "subjective" test requiring proof of actual partiality of the member concerned. Secondly, an "objective" test where the deciding Board judges whether any circumstances of the case give rise to an objectively justified fear of partiality (point 9).

2. In the absence of exceptional circumstances, any procedural error in admitting requests would relate simply to flaws in the steps that the Board necessarily has to take to reach a decision. Thus, under the objective test, not admitting amended claims, regardless of whether the Board has correctly used its power or discretion to do so, does not give rise to any objectively justified fear of partiality (point 20).

3. At the beginning of an appeal case where a properly constituted Board has not performed a procedural step, there are generally no circumstances that give rise to an objectively justified fear of partiality based on circumstances in a previous case (point 22).

4. The mere fact that the member concerned gives reasons and explanations of the reasons, which go beyond the facts, in response to an invitation under Article 3(2) RPBA does not give rise to an objectively justified fear of partiality under the objective test (point 27).

ORDER

For these reasons it is decided that:

The objection of suspected partiality against the original chairman of the board is refused.
